Warning Signs You Need Temperature-Controlled Drying

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Our team is here to help you identify the warning signs and address them before they become major issues.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ty odor in your home that won’t go away, it’s a sign that there’s excess moisture present. This can lead to mold growth, which can cause health problems and damage your property.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to address it.

Water Spots on Ceilings or Walls

Water spots on ceilings or walls are a common sign of water damage. If left unchecked, these spots can become stains and lead to structural issues. Our team can help you identify the source of the water damage and provide a solution to address it.

Temperature-Controlled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is fine for small spills, but for larger areas, call a pro.
Water damage due to flooding or sewage backup No Yes For severe water damage, call a pro to ensure thorough drying and restoration.
Visible signs of mold growth No Yes Don’t risk your health and property by trying to remove mold yourself. Call a pro.
Large water spill (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es For large water spills, call a pro to ensure thorough drying and restoration.
Structural damage due to water exposure No Yes Structural damage needs professional attention to ensure your property remains safe and secure.
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under flooring) No Yes Hidden water damage needs professional detection and repair to prevent further damage.

With Temperature-Controlled Drying, it’s essential to call a professional if you notice any warning signs or suspect water damage. Temperature-Controlled Drying Cost in Remington, VA

The cost of Temperature-Controlled Drying in Remington, VA var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and should serve as a rough guide only.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Equipment Setup $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and Monitoring $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of drying process
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ed
Structural Drying $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
